I am living in a rented flat & want to enroll for GSTP exam but my rent agreement has already expired.
What would be any alternate document for professional address proof ?

At first, you must refer Rule 83 &84 of CGST Rules 2017 in which stated the Provisions relating to a Goods and Service Tax Practitioner. If you are qualified as per the provisions you must apply for enrolment in form GST PCT-01 through comon portal of GST directly.
Yes. In the PCT-01, there is a column to fill the Professional address. You can fill your address in Aadhar Card as Professional Address and produce the Aadhar card as evidence.
You need to provide either legal ownership of property, property tax slip, electricity bill or municipal khata copy, if you do not have any of it then you must renew your rent agreement. I hope this helps. Thank you.
